WHAT DOES THIS COMPANY DO?
Aktis Oncology, Inc. What it actually does.

Develop targeted radiopharmaceutical therapies for cancer treatment. Utilize a miniprotein radioconjugate platform to deliver radioisotopes to tumors. Now — the numbers.
